    MASSOB urges Igbos to leave North over Boko Haram Killings *Christians Killing Must Stop –Pope Benedict



    As attacks on Christians by violent Boko Haram Sect  continue almost unhindered in the north, the leader of the movement for the actualisation of sovereign state of Biafra (MASSOB), Chief Ralph Uwazuruike has called on Igbos to leave the troubled zones in northern Nigeria. Nwazurike lamented attacks and killings of innocent worshippers at churches adding that when such bloody attacks happen Ndigbos are worst hit.
    He also blasted the security agencies for failing to end the killings and growing insecurity in northern part of the country. Also speaking on the violence in Nigeria,  Pope Benedict XVI called for an end to the killings of Christians even as he warned against reprisal attacks from both sides. “I appeal to those responsible for the violence to immediately stop the spilling of the blood of many  innocent people.” the pope stated.
    Meanwhile, death toll has hit about 80 in Sunday’s  multiple attacks on three churches in Kaduna, North central Nigeria  and a gun battle between Boko Haram and security agencies in Damaturu, Yobe state, North-east Nigeria.
